Ingredients
Scale
Sherbet:
- 1 can (14 oz) sweetened condensed milk
- 1 liter Orange Crush soda (chilled)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of salt
Instructions
- Mix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, gently whisk together the sweetened condensed milk, Orange Crush soda,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t until fully combined and slightly foamy.
- Freeze Mixture: Pour the mixture into a freezer-safe container or loaf pan. Cover tightly with plastic wrap or a lid and freeze for 4–6 hours, or until firm. For a creamier texture, stir the mixture every hour for the first 3 hours to break up ice crystals.
- Serve: Once fully frozen, scoop and serve like traditional sherbet. Let sit at room temperature for a few minutes if it’s too firm to scoop.
Notes
- You can use any orange-flavored soda, but Orange Crush gives it the classic vibrant flavor.
- For an extra-creamy version, blend in 1/2 cup heavy cream before freezing.
